自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 资源 (1)
  • 收藏
  • 关注

原创 RISC-V MCU开发笔记--基于HPM6750

RISC-V MCU HPM6750使用笔记

2022-08-18 17:12:20 644 1

原创 搭建Doxygen环境从代码中提取文档——Doxygen安装

搭建Doxygen环境从代码中提取文档——Doxygen安装文章目录搭建Doxygen环境从代码中提取文档——Doxygen安装目标:ubuntu 20.04 安装 Doxygenapt 命令安装使用Doxygen官网提供的bin文件安装目标: 使用Doxygen提取C源码中的文档 搭建LaTeX环境,生成pdf文件 使用plantUML插入UML图ubuntu 20.04 安装 Doxygenapt 命令安装sudo apt install doxygen# 将建议安装的软件也安

2022-05-23 22:11:10 231

原创 GoCD使用日记(1)

GoCD使用日记(1)目录GoCD使用日记(1)安装开启认证安装安装指导开启认证指导

2020-08-12 19:52:06 494

原创 cmocka的学习(2)

cmocka的学习(2)-配置头文件config.h生成脚本目录cmocka的学习(2)-配置头文件config.h生成脚本重点函数说明check_include_file(file.ext VAR)check_function_exists(calloc HAVE_CALLOC)check_symbol_exists(snprintf stdio.h HAVE_SNPRINTF)cmocka源码重点函数说明check_include_file(file.h VAR)check_function_

2020-08-11 00:04:10 787

原创 cmocka的学习(1)

使用clang编译cmocka,并执行其测试程序

2020-08-07 22:41:25 2832 1

原创 python实现文本编码转换

python实现文本编码转换目录python实现文本编码转换下列python可以将当前目录及子目录内的 .h和.c文件的编码批量转换为utf-8 BOMimport chardetimport osdef get_encoding(file): with open(file, "rb") as f: data = f.read() return chardet.detect(data)["encoding"]for root, dirs, file

2020-08-07 14:24:25 436

原创 嵌入式TDD实践记录(01)

最近参与进一个项目,代码真的很乱.项目使用了RTOS, 但是好像当初设计的时候没有很好的做任务划分.主要体现在:任务职责不清晰 任务间的使用队列通信,但是对队列中携带的数据的数据格式没有明晰的定义 代码之间耦合的厉害,状态和数据没有统一的管理,都是通过全局变量来进行操作的修改这样的代码真的很崩溃!所以一冲动之下就去图书馆找了一些如何编码的书来看!这里列一个书单:<...

2019-04-20 21:01:42 255

CAN总线完全指南(含UDS)

详细介绍CAN的链路层/传输层和应用层协议,包括 J1939/CANOPEN/UDSonCAN/OBD-II/CAN-FD等协议。包括大量配图形象的解析协议。 由各个协议的历史介绍和最新进展。 熟悉汽车诊断协议的入门文档之一。

2022-10-24

Cortex-M0 HardFault定位

该文件用于指导定位程序是从哪里进入的HardFault的,定位程序出错的地点

2015-11-17

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除